    Re: [SINGLE] AKB48 - [Ponytail to Shushu] - 2010/05/26

    That's a play on numbers / words.
    373 = Mi na mi
    It's called goroawase.
    Most people probably know 39 = san kyu = "thank you"
    possible others:
    08 = o ya
    210 = ni tou
    310 = sa tou
    017 = re i na
    723 = na tsu mi
    and so on...
